    Dameon Pierce Jul 20 1:30pm ET
    Dameon Pierce

    Houston Texans running back Dameon Pierce, who will enter the 2024 season as the backup to new lead back Joe Mixon, has looked good early on in training camp. Pierce was more decisive on his runs on the first day of camp on Saturday and could form a strong 1-2 punch with Mixon if he continues to look this good once the pads go on and to open the regular season. The 24-year-old former fourth-round pick in 2022 out of Florida nearly ran for 1,000 yards in just 13 games in his rookie season in 2022 before disappointing in his sophomore year in 2023 and losing the starting job to Devin Singletary. Pierce could excel with Houston moving to an outside-zone scheme, but as long as Mixon stays healthy, he probably won't be anything more than a handcuff option in fantasy leagues.

    Arik Armstead Jul 20 1:30pm ET
    Arik Armstead

    The Jacksonville Jaguars placed defensive lineman Arik Armstead (knee) on the Physically Unable to Perform list on Saturday. Armstead is not ready to practice with the rest of the team for the start of training camp after he had surgery to fix a torn meniscus in his right knee this offseason. Barring a setback in the 30-year-old's recovery, though, Armstead could be activated from the PUP list and be ready to go for the start of the 2024 regular season in Week 1 in September. The former 17th overall pick of the San Francisco 49ers in 2015 out of Oregon racked up 302 tackles (177 solo), 33.5 sacks, 43 tackles for loss and 88 QB hits in his nine seasons with the Niners before joining the Jaguars this offseason. He played in only 12 regular-season games in 2023 and had just 27 tackles (15 solo) and five sacks.

    Josh Palmer Jul 20 1:20pm ET
    Josh Palmer

    The Athletic's Daniel Popper thinks Los Angeles Chargers wide receivers Joshua Palmer, rookie Ladd McConkey and DJ Chark Jr. will start in 11 personnel packages to begin the 2024 season. McConkey was mostly playing the slot in spring practices, Palmer can play inside and outside, and Chark fits as a true X receiver due to his size, speed and contested-catch ability. Palmer could emerge as quarterback Justin Herbert's top target because he's already established rapport with Herbert and is the most complete receiver in the Chargers' receiving corps. But McConkey is extremely refined as a route-runner and will push for targets immediately. As of right now, it looks like former first-rounder Quentin Johnston is the No. 4 after displaying poor route-running and key drops in his rookie campaign. Palmer has plenty of opportunity in 2024 and is worth a late-round flier as a fantasy sleeper.

    Javonte Williams Jul 20 1:10pm ET
    Javonte Williams

    The Denver Post's Troy Renck believes that Denver Broncos running backs Javonte Williams and Samaje Perine are competing for one roster spot in training camp and the preseason this year as the Broncos look to improve what was a very lackluster rushing offense in 2023. Williams is entering his fourth NFL season and averaged 3.2 yards per carry over the final 10 games last year. The poor efficiency could be attributed to it being his first full season coming off a serious knee injury, and he looked bigger and stronger this spring. Perine is a trusted third-down weapon that excels in pass protection. Rookie Audric Estime is going to make the team, and if he really impresses, it could put Williams' spot in jeopardy. We'd be surprised if the Broncos outright cut Williams, but it's a reminder of how far his fantasy stock has fallen after he had RB1 upside heading into the 2022 season.

    MarShawn Lloyd Jul 19 11:50pm ET
    MarShawn Lloyd

    Green Bay Packers offensive coordinator Adam Stenavich basically has already said that rookie running back MarShawn Lloyd won't ride the bench like AJ Dillon did as a rookie. Lloyd brings shiftiness and explosiveness to the position, a much different element than Dillon brings, and it was evident during offseason practices. The Packers will want to see more of that from Lloyd in training camp this summer, as well as an ability to pass protect and catch passes. Head coach Matt LaFleur likes his backs to be well-versed in all aspects of the position. Josh Jacobs is the clear lead back for the Packers heading into the 2024 season, so Lloyd may be left to the waiver wire in standard 12-team leagues, but the third-rounder's combination of power and speed make him an intriguing big-play threat. Playing time and fumbling issues could be Lloyd's biggest obstacles as he heads to the next level.

    Eddie Jackson Jul 19 11:50pm ET
    Eddie Jackson

    Two-time Pro Bowl safety Eddie Jackson reached an agreement on Friday with the Baltimore Ravens on an undisclosed one-year deal, according to sources. Jackson scored six defensive touchdowns for the Chicago Bears in his six years with the organization and will now bring his talents to Baltimore's secondary in 2024. The 30-year-old was selected by the Bears in the fourth round (112th overall) in the 2017 NFL draft out of Alabama and made the Pro Bowl in two straight seasons in 2018 and 2019, his second and third seasons in the league. He was released by Chicago in February and should serve in a backup role behind Marcus Williams and Kyle Hamilton in his first year with the Ravens. Jackson has racked up 459 tackles (355 solo), two sacks, 14 tackles for loss, 15 interceptions (three returned for touchdowns), 44 pass breakups, 10 forced fumbles and six fumble recoveries (three for TDs) in 100 career starts.

    Jonathon Brooks Jul 19 9:20pm ET
    Jonathon Brooks

    The Carolina Panthers placed running back Jonathon Brooks on the Active/NFI list on Friday night. The rookie, who suffered a torn ACL in November while with his collegiate squad, can be activated at any time. However, he will be forced to miss the first four contests if he isn't cleared to play before the 2024-25 campaign starts. Brooks, the No. 46 pick of the 2024 NFL Draft, began his career behind Bijan Robinson at Texas. But after taking over as the lead option in 2023, he ran for 1,139 yards and 10 touchdowns off 187 touches, averaging 6.1 yards per carry. At any rate, Brooks will likely be brought along slowly once he's healthy enough to return to the field. Although he could work his way to the top of the depth chart at some point, he may not make an immediate impact for fantasy managers.

    Kenyan Drake Jul 19 8:50pm ET
    Kenyan Drake

    Running back Kenyan Drake announced his retirement on Friday. The 2016 No. 73 overall pick played for five teams after entering the NFL, making stops in Miami, Arizona, Las Vegas, Baltimore, and Green Bay. Throughout his career, he established himself as a legit dual-threat back, amassing 3,866 rushing yards and 1,655 receiving yards while totaling 41 touchdowns in 104 regular-season contests. Although Drake wasn't as potent near the end of his time in the National Football League, he still had more than a few productive years for fantasy managers.

    Gerald Everett Jul 19 4:00pm ET
    Gerald Everett

    The Chicago Bears placed veteran tight end Gerald Everett (undisclosed) on the Non-Football Injury list on Friday. The Bears didn't give a specific injury for Everett, but he did injure his knee in the Week 18 regular-season finale with the Los Angeles Chargers. The 30-year-old is now in Chicago in 2024 and will serve as a backup at the position behind Cole Kmet when he's healthy, which will make him unattractive in the vast majority of fantasy leagues. The former second-round pick by the Los Angeles Rams in 2017 has only gone over 500 receiving yards once in his career and has never scored more than four touchdowns in a single season, so his upside was already limited. In 15 games (12 starts) for the Bolts last year, Everett hauled in 51 of his 70 targets for 411 yards and three touchdowns. It remains to be seen if Everett will even be ready for the start of the regular season.

    Joe Mixon Jul 19 3:30pm ET
    Joe Mixon

    New Houston Texans running back Joe Mixon said he sees himself having a heavy workload with a role that he's been preparing for in his first year in the Texans' offense. As long as Mixon is able to stay healthy, he will be Houston's clear lead runner after finishing fifth in the NFL in carries with 257 in 17 games in 2023 in his final year with the Cincinnati Bengals. The 27-year-old racked up 1,034 rushing yards on his 257 carries, which ranked in the top 10 in the league at the position, although his 4.0 yards per carry left a lot to be desired. Mixon is probably going to need to be more efficient as a runner in his first year in Houston to finish as an RB1 in fantasy, because fantasy managers probably won't be able to count on him being as involved in the passing game for the Texans as he was in Cincinnati. But in Houston's ascending that is led by impressive second-year quarterback C.J. Stroud, Mixon should at least be a strong RB2 target in fantasy drafts.

    J.J. McCarthy Jul 19 3:10pm ET
    J.J. McCarthy

    Minnesota Vikings No. 10 overall pick J.J. McCarthy signed a four-year, fully-guaranteed rookie contract on Friday that is worth $21.85 million and also includes a $12.71 million signing bonus and a fifth-year team option, according to sources. McCarthy won a national championship at Michigan in his final season in college and is now hoping to be the Vikings' next franchise signal-caller, although it won't come right away. Former first-rounder Sam Darnold is fully expected to open the year as the starter under center in Minnesota, with McCarthy learning on the sidelines. Most evaluators don't see a ton of upside in McCarthy at the next level, but it doesn't mean he won't be making some starts later on in the 2024 campaign. McCarthy can be avoided in single-year fantasy leagues.

    Juwan Johnson Jul 19 3:10pm ET
    Juwan Johnson

    The New Orleans Saints put tight end Juwan Johnson (foot) on the Physically Unable to Perform list on Thursday. It means that Johnson won't be ready to join the rest of the team in practices for the start of training camp next week after he had surgery for a foot injury that he suffered in minicamp this offseason. However, the 27-year-old should work off to the side for the start of camp and still has a shot to be ready for the start of the 2024 regular season in Week 1 this fall. If Johnson is limited or out to begin the season, Foster Moreau and Taysom Hill will have more opportunities to catch passes at the tight end position in the Big Easy. Johnson took a step back in 2023 with quarterback Derek Carr at the helm, catching 37 passes for 368 yards and four touchdowns in 13 games (11 starts). When healthy, he checks in as a touchdown-dependent, low-end TE2 in fantasy.
